From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913) (web1913)
Undeceive \Un`de*ceive"\, v. t. [1st pref. un- + deceive.]
To cause to be no longer deceived; to free from deception,
fraud, fallacy, or mistake. --South.
From WordNet (r) 1.7 (wn)
undeceive
v : free from deception or illusion [ant: {deceive}]
